- Abstract : Microgels enable reversible stabilization of liquid crystal (LC) emulsions in ways that facilitate analysis of LC droplets that undergo an analyte-triggered conformational transition. Abstract : We develop a new strategy that involves the formation of microgel (MG) decorated liquid crystal (LC) droplets, which show remarkable stability. This system facilitates the analysis of the LC droplets that undergo an analyte-triggered conformational transition, thus optimizing the quantitation of aqueous analytes.
